A Cockapoo is a popular and affectionate hybrid dog breed resulting from the crossbreeding of a Cocker Spaniel and a Poodle.

Cockapoo
Here’s some information about Cockapoos:
| Topic | Information |
| Breed Classification | Cockapoos are considered a designer dog breed, resulting from the crossbreeding of a Cocker Spaniel and a Poodle. |
| Physical Appearance | Size: Cockapoos come in various sizes, depending on the type of Poodle used in the cross. They can range from small to medium-sized dogs. |
| Coat: They have a curly or wavy coat that can vary in color and texture. Their coat may inherit traits from both parent breeds. | |
| Behavior and Personality | Friendly and Affectionate: Cockapoos are known for their friendly and affectionate nature. They tend to form strong bonds with their families. |
| Intelligent and Trainable: They are usually intelligent and easy to train, making them suitable for obedience training and interactive play. | |
| Diet and Nutrition | Cockapoos require a well-balanced dog food diet suitable for their size and activity level. Portion control is important to maintain a healthy weight. |
| Exercise Needs | These dogs benefit from regular exercise to stay healthy and burn off their energy. Daily walks and playtime are essential. |
| Predators and Threats | In a domestic setting, Cockapoos are generally safe from natural predators. They may be susceptible to specific health issues common in small dog breeds. |
| Interesting Facts and Features | Hypoallergenic Traits: Some Cockapoos may inherit hypoallergenic traits from their Poodle parent, making them suitable for people with allergies. |
| Designer Dog Popularity: Cockapoos are part of the designer dog trend, known for combining desirable traits from both parent breeds. | |
| Relationship with Humans | Cockapoos are known for their sociable and loving nature, making them excellent companion animals suitable for families, singles, and seniors. |
| Conservation Status and Life Today | Cockapoos are not considered a distinct breed by major kennel clubs but are recognized as popular and cherished pets. They continue to be sought after as affectionate and adaptable companions. |
